What I Looked for Before Buying

Before I made a decision, I checked a few important things:

  • Vehicle compatibility: I made sure the shocks matched my exact make, model, and year.
  • Driving style: I thought about whether I mostly drive on highways, city roads, or rougher surfaces.
  • Load needs: I considered if I regularly carry heavy loads or tow anything.
  • Ride preference: I wanted a smoother ride, but still enough firmness for control.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

I found it helpful to have the shocks installed by someone with the right tools and experience. After installation, I checked for any unusual noises or handling changes during the first few drives. I also made a habit of inspecting the shocks periodically for leaks, wear, or damage to make sure they stayed in good condition.
